Benefits of Magnolia Exterior Paint

Magnolia Exterior Paint offers several advantages that make it an outstanding choice for your home’s exterior. Understanding these benefits can help you appreciate why this brand has gained popularity among homeowners and contractors alike.

First, Magnolia Exterior Paint is known for its durability. Formulated to withstand various weather conditions, it provides a protective barrier against moisture, UV rays, and temperature fluctuations. This durability means that your home will not only look great but will also be safeguarded against the elements, reducing the need for frequent repainting.

Moreover, Magnolia paints are eco-friendly, incorporating low-VOC (volatile organic compounds) formulations. This aspect is crucial for homeowners concerned about their environmental footprint and indoor air quality. Using low-VOC paints means fewer harmful emissions, making it safer for you and your family, as well as for the environment.

Choosing the Right Colors

Choosing the right color for your home can be one of the most exciting yet challenging aspects of the painting process. Magnolia Exterior Paint provides a diverse palette for homeowners to explore. However, it’s essential to consider several factors when selecting the perfect shade.

First, assess your home’s architectural style. Certain colors work better with specific styles. For instance, traditional homes often benefit from classic shades like whites, creams, or muted earth tones, while modern designs can handle bolder colors or unique combinations that make a statement.

Another important factor is the surrounding environment. Consider the natural landscape, neighboring homes, and any existing features, such as brick or stonework. Choosing colors that harmonize with these elements will create a more unified and appealing look. For example, greens and browns can complement a wooded area, while lighter shades can brighten up a coastal property.

Creating a Color Scheme

When creating a color scheme, it’s helpful to use the 60-30-10 rule, which is a design guideline that suggests using 60% of a dominant color, 30% of a secondary color, and 10% of an accent color. This rule can help you balance your choices effectively.

  • Dominant Color: This will be the primary color of your home, typically used on the main body of the house.
  • Secondary Color: Use this for trim, shutters, or accents. It should complement the dominant color and add depth to the overall look.
  • Accent Color: This is used sparingly, perhaps on the front door or decorative elements, to create focal points and interest.

Additionally, consider the emotional impact of color. Colors can evoke feelings and set the mood for your home. For example, blues and greens are calming, while reds and yellows can energize and uplift. Think about how you want your home to feel both inside and out.

The Application Process

Once you’ve chosen the perfect colors, the next step is to prepare for the application of Magnolia Exterior Paint. Proper preparation is key to achieving a beautiful and long-lasting finish. Here’s how to get started.

Begin by cleaning the surfaces that will be painted. Remove dirt, mildew, and loose paint using a pressure washer or a scrub brush with a mixture of water and mild detergent. This ensures that the new paint adheres properly and lasts longer. If you notice any peeling paint, it’s best to sand those areas down to create a smooth surface.

Next, make any necessary repairs to the siding, trim, or other surfaces. Fill in cracks and holes with caulk or wood filler, and sand these areas once dry. It’s also a good idea to apply a primer, especially if you’re making a significant color change or painting over a surface that’s never been painted before.

Applying the Paint

With your surfaces prepared, it’s time to apply the Magnolia Exterior Paint. Start by using a high-quality brush or roller, and consider using a paint sprayer for larger areas to save time. If you’re using a brush, work in manageable sections, applying the paint in even strokes to avoid streaks.

  • Apply Two Coats: For optimal coverage, it’s recommended to apply at least two coats of paint. Allow the first coat to dry completely before applying the second coat.
  • Check the Weather: Make sure to paint on a dry day with mild temperatures. Avoid painting in direct sunlight or extreme humidity, as these conditions can affect drying times and the paint’s adherence.
  • Inspect and Touch Up: After the paint has dried, inspect the surface for any missed spots or imperfections, and touch these areas up as needed.

Finally, take the time to clean your tools properly after painting. This will ensure that they remain in good condition for future use and that you can tackle other projects without any hassle.

Maintenance Tips for Longevity

After transforming your home with Magnolia Exterior Paint, maintaining its beauty is essential. Regular maintenance can help prolong the life of your paint job and keep your home looking fresh and inviting. Here are some practical tips to follow.

Start with regular inspections of your home’s exterior. Look for signs of wear, such as peeling paint, mold, or mildew.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ent more extensive damage and the need for a complete repaint sooner than necessary.

Cleaning your home’s exterior at least once a year is also crucial. A simple wash with a mixture of water and mild detergent can remove dirt and grime that accumulate over time. For more stubborn stains or mildew, consider using a pressure washer or a specialized cleaning solution, especially if you live in a humid climate.

Seasonal Considerations

Paying attention to seasonal changes can also aid in maintenance. In the fall, check for leaves or debris that may have collected in gutters or on the roof. Clogged gutters can lead to water damage, which can affect your paint job. During winter, inspect for ice damage or cracks that may develop due to freezing temperatures.

  • Touch-up as Needed: Keep a small supply of your Magnolia Exterior Paint on hand for quick touch-ups throughout the year.
  • Inspect Trim and Doors: Pay special attention to painted trim and doors, as these areas often experience more wear and tear.
  • Repaint When Necessary: Generally, exterior paint should last between 5 to 10 years. If you notice significant fading or peeling, it may be time for a refresh.
